WebbSimilar to “I told you so,” “I called it” is sometimes seen as gloating. However, “I called it” isn’t considered to be snotty or bratty like “I told you so” sometimes is. Here’s how you can use this phrase: I just got off the phone with Jeremy. He got the job! I called it! I think Connie and Mark are dating. Called it.
